Job Description

Description

The Projects Transition Specialist will be responsible for overseeing the organization's Plan-to-Build Policy, ensuring seamless transitions of Renewable Energy (RE) projects from origination through development and construction to operations by successfully navigating stage gate reviews. S/he will also be responsible for facilitating independent assessments of facilities, systems, manpower, and compliance readiness prior to plant turnover.


RENEWABLE ENERGY GROWTH PROJECTS TRANSITIONS

  • Assesses and tracks RE growth project activities by analyzing project readiness data and ensuring alignment with the Plan-to-Build Policy and Stage Gate Project Management Model.
  • Prepares and consolidates project documentation, including stage gate review requirements, by working closely with process owners and stakeholders to ensure seamless transitions.
  • Facilitates coordination and communication between teams, ensuring that gate review meetings are well-organized, documented, and issues are proactively addressed.
  • Analyzes project transition risks by identifying potential challenges and working with stakeholders to develop mitigation strategies.
  • Provides operational insights by conducting independent assessments and making recommendations to supervisors and management on project readiness and areas for improvement.
  • Supports process owners and project leads by ensuring compliance with transition policies and addressing gaps in project execution.
  • Supports the development and implementation of process improvements in collaboration with cross-functional teams to streamline project transitions and enhance efficiency.


OPERATIONAL READINESS REVIEW

  • Manages and monitors ORR activities by tracking progress against operational readiness requirements and escalating issues as needed.
  • Develops and refines ORR checklists and assessment criteria by collaborating with process owners, ensuring operational readiness standards are met.
  • Facilitates ORR preparation efforts by conducting preliminary readiness assessments and coordinating essential workshops to align stakeholders.
  • Conducts in-depth Walk-the-Line inspections by identifying potential operational risks and ensuring corrective actions are taken before turnover.
  • Facilitates post-transition evaluations to capture lessons learned and implement best practices for future projects.
  • Provides detailed reports and presentations on ORR status, highlighting key findings and recommendations to management for decision-making.
  • Facilitates regular ORR sessions with ORR leads, subject matter experts, and key stakeholders to drive resolutions, maintain momentum, and achieve operational readiness goals.
  • Supports the development and implementation of process improvements in collaboration with cross-functional teams to improve the operational readiness review process.
